Check the float level, if its high, itll cause rich running.
If you go to a hotter plug, youll just be dealing with the symtoms, and not the problem. Theres got to be a reason, its running rich, and youd be better off fixing that. Keep looking, youll figure it out.
How was the mixture screw, setting? Should be somewhere around 1 1/2 turns out.
The valves could be out of adjustment...that would cause hard starting, but not fouled plugs.
